Development Update: Tuesday, May 21
By The Futon Critic Staff (TFC)

LOS ANGELES (thefutoncritic.com) -- The latest development news, culled from recent wire reports:

COBRA KAI (YouTube) - Creators Jon Hurwitz, Josh Heald and Hayden Schlossberg have signed a three-year overall deal with producer Sony Pictures Television. The pact calls for them to continue on the series as well as develop new series projects via their newly formed Counterbalance Entertainment banner. (Deadline.com)
CONNERS, THE (ABC) - Executive producers Sara Gilbert and Tom Werner have teamed up to launch a production company, sara + tom. (Deadline.com)
GOOD PEOPLE (Amazon) - Greg Kinnear is set to star opposite Lisa Kudrow in the half-hour comedy pilot as Dr. Paul Keating, "the incredibly charismatic and charming philosophy professor at Sacramento University. He's Indiana Jones-meets-Joan Didion. He causes problems for Lynn Steele (Kudrow) and Hazel Miller (Whitney Cummings) because of his unorthodox methods of teaching and refusal to acquiesce to "PC" rules." (Deadline.com)
HIGH FIDELITY (Hulu) - Kingsley Ben-Adir has landed a recurring role on the Nick Hornby series as Russell "Mac" McCormack: "He's charming, worldly, intelligent - though not at all pretentious - and was Rob's most serious boyfriend. Everything seemed to be great, then one day he moved to London, and a year later Rob is still getting over it. But Mac may not be gone from her life for good." (Deadline.com)
LORD OF THE RINGS, THE (Amazon) - "Game of Thrones" alum Bryan Cogman has been tapped to consult on the upcoming J.R.R. Tolkien series, where he'll work alongside co-creators J.D. Payne and Patrick McKay. (Variety.com)
SUCCESSION (HBO) - Holly Hunter has signed on to recur on the new season as Rhea Jarrell, "the politically savvy CEO of a rival media conglomerate." (Deadline.com)
UNORTHODOX (Netflix) - Shira Haas, Jeff Wilbusch and Amit Rahav are set to star in the four-part series, which is inspired by Deborah Feldman's New York Times bestselling book of the same name. Production is underway in Berlin with Maria Schrader directing from a script by Anna Winger and Alexa Karolinski. Winger and Henning Kamm are the producers. (Deadline.com)
